What are uppers in shoes?

What are uppers in shoes?

Upper: The entire part of the shoe that covers the foot. The upper of a shoe consists of all parts or sections of the shoe above the sole. These are attached by stitches or more likely moulded to become a single unit then the insole and outsole are attached.

Why do shoes have tongues?

The tongue sits on the top center part of the shoe on top of the bridge of the foot. It’s attached to the vamp and runs all the way to the throat of the shoe. Tongues are found on any shoe with laces. It protects the top of the foot and prevents laces from rubbing against the foot.

Why are chucks good for lifting?

Converse shoes are ideal for powerlifting because of their flat sole and high ankle support. The flat sole allows lifters to feel better connected to the floor, which increases balance and reduces the overall range of motion (during deadlifts).

What are the 2 holes in Converse for?

Aside from allowing your feet to breathe when you are not wearing socks, the holes are also meant to be used for β€œbar lacing.” This method allows your shoes to be tighter around your feet.

How do you double lace a shoe?

Tie two knots across the shoe – one knot across the top row of eyelets, the other knot across the second from top row of eyelets (as per the shoe on the left). Alternatively, tie two knots along the shoe – one knot using the two left ends and the other knot using the two right ends (as per the shoe on the right).

How do you loop back lace shoes?

Lacing Technique Begin straight across on the inside (grey section) and out through the bottom eyelets. At each eyelet pair, the ends are given a half twist in the middle of the shoe before looping back and returning to the outside. The ends are fed under the sides and out through the next higher set of eyelets.

What is the loop on the back of shoes for?

The loop on the back of shoes is to help you pull the back of the shoe up over your heel.

What means lace shoes?

Lace-up shoes are the most common type of shoe. As their name indicates, they’re closed by means of a shoelace that’s laced through eyelets or lugs. There are two main varieties of lace-up shoes: those with closed lacing, and those with open lacing.

What is a ladder lace?

Distinctive lacing worn on military boots by paratroopers and others. The laces weave horizontally and vertically, forming a secure ladder.
